Avalanche danger is CONSIDERABLE. Due to higher temperatures and solar radiation on Saturday, naturally triggered wet-snow and glide-snow avalanches are expected, mostly medium sized, also larger. Avalanche activity will swiftly increase, esp. on S/E facing slopes, in late morning, then spread to all aspects over the course of the day. Esp. in rocky terrain with little snow isolated wet-snow slab avalanches are also possible, these can plummet down to ground where there is no snow on the ground. Backcountry tours should pay close heed to the march of time during the day, and its results.
A melt-freeze crust forms at night which then softens during the morning. The timing and extent of moisture is decided by altitude, aspect and steepness gradient. On very steep slopes in E/S aspects the snowpack begins to moisten. On south-facing slopes in high alpine regions, on E/W facing slopes below 3000 m, on north-facing slopes below 2600 m the snowpack is becoming thoroughly wet for the first time, and thereby weakening. The stable old snowpack is causing most releases to be glide-snow avalanches and loose wet-snow avalanches. Wet slab avalanches are more likely where there is little snow and in rocky terrain. Due to the loss of firmness of the snowpack, the glide-snow and wet-snow avalanches can sweep lots of wet snow along in their plummet path, reach zones where there is no snow on the ground.
A few clouds will pass through at night, somewhat reducing the outgoing radiation of the snowpack. On Monday, too warm at all altitudes, mostly sunny, possible penetration of Sahara dust. Southerly foehn wind will intensify, reaching the Northern Alps. At 2000 m: 12-15 degrees; at 3000m: 5-7 degrees.
High wet-snow/gliding snow activity will persist.
